Baby P Mum Release Bid Fury
Quote:
OUTRAGE last night greeted a bid by Baby P’s evil mother Tracey Connelly to be freed from jail. Connelly, jailed over the horrific 2007 killing of baby son Peter, has passed the minimum five years she was ordered to serve and could be given parole within weeks.
